📜 The Ghost of 2002: Can Senegal Shock the World Again?
For football fans, the mention of "France vs Senegal" immediately brings back memories of the 2002 World Cup opening match. Back then, a debutant Senegal side led by El Hadji Diouf stunned the defending champions with a 1-0 victory. Twenty-four years later, the "Lions of Teranga" return with more experience and a squad filled with European stars, while France looks to assert its dominance and avoid another historic upset.
"Fun Fact: Aliou Cissé, the legendary coach of Senegal, was the captain of the team that beat France in 2002. His tactical battle against Didier Deschamps will be the highlight of Match 17."
